We’re less than two weeks out from WOTS 2018 and with over 150 authors and over 15 stages there’s so much to check out! It’s going to be a busy and bustling day and we want to make sure you don’t miss a thing!
You can always find where your favourite authors will be on our website, but if you’re having trouble deciding where to head on September 23rd, then take a look at these not-to-be-missed programs!
Our Indigenous Voices stage is returning this year! This stage is dedicated to Indigenous authors and literatures. Come hear some readings, or head over for a language lesson and you’ll learn some phrases in Cree or Anishinaabemowin! Attend the Opening and Closing ceremonies for a call to action on how we can move forward with reconciliation.
If you’re an aspiring poet, you definitely want to sign-up for the Franc’Open Mic Workshop! This workshop will use games and group activities to develop creativity, imagination and writing techniques! Not fluent in French? The workshop can be offered in both French and English.
Want to add a little extra fun to your WOTS day? Come see your favourite authors live on the WOTS Author Cruises! Romance fans should hop aboard The Love Boat, featuring Maggie K. Black, Stefanie London, and Mary Sullivan. Or do you experience some wanderlust? Grab tickets for Across Water, Across Time. Authors Alex Boyd, Andrea Curtis, and Kerri Sakamoto will be talking about their adventures on the water.
TD Kidstreet is an entire section of the festival that’s Just For Kids! Well, and of course their families. Kids can get to know the authors and illustrators of their favourite books at the TD Children’s Literature stage! Do they love play? They can engage with some hands-on learning over at the Children’s Activity Tent! They can draw along with story time or create their very own characters.
Do you speak French? Want to learn more? Then come on over to our French programming down at La scène Viamonde! There will be a mix of children’s and adults’ programming and you can finish off the day by watching the Franc’Open Mic Slam, an all-French open stage!
Want the bestselling books at the festival? Head on over to the Amazon.ca Bestsellers stage! You can hear popular authors like Kenneth Oppel, Linwood Barclay, Hana Shafi, and Amy Stuart talking about their latest books!
Our Great Books Stage features dynamic books from every genre— from fiction to poetry to non-fiction! Hear from authors of these awesome Canadian books like Sharon Bala, Joanna Goodman, Michael Barclay, and Nathan Ripley.
Are you an aspiring writer? Hoping to be featured at a future WOTS festival? Drop by the Studio Theatre for the Humber Wordshop Marquee! You can drop off the first page of your manuscript at the First Page Challenge for a chance to have your work assessed on stage. Learn from the faculty at the Humber School for Writers at one of their writing or career strategy workshops!
